The Ryzen 7 5700X is manufactured by AMD. It was released in 4 April 2022 (3 years ago). It is based on the Vermeer (Zen 3) (2020−2022) architecture. It features 8 cores and 16 threads. Base frequency is 3.4 GHz, with boost up to 4.6 GHz. L3 cache: 32 MB (total). L2 cache: 512K (per core). Built on 7 nm process technology. Socket: AM4. Thermal design power (TDP): 65 Watt. Memory support: DDR4-3200. Passmark benchmark score: 26,609 points. Launch price was $299.

Intel

Xeon Platinum 8362

The Xeon Platinum 8362 is manufactured by Intel. It was released in 2021-04-01. It is based on the Ice Lake-SP (2021) architecture. It features 32 cores and 64 threads. Base frequency is 2.8 GHz, with boost up to 3.6 GHz. L3 cache: 48 MB (total). L2 cache: 1 MB (per core). Built on 10 nm process technology. Socket: LGA4189. Thermal design power (TDP): 265 Watt. Memory support: DDR4-3200. Passmark benchmark score: 56,787 points. Launch price was $3,500.

Processing Power

The Ryzen 7 5700X packs 8 cores / 16 threads, while the Xeon Platinum 8362 offers 32 cores / 64 threads — the Xeon Platinum 8362 has 24 more cores. Boost clocks reach 4.6 GHz on the Ryzen 7 5700X versus 3.6 GHz on the Xeon Platinum 8362 — a 24.4% clock advantage for the Ryzen 7 5700X (base: 3.4 GHz vs 2.8 GHz). The Ryzen 7 5700X uses the Vermeer (Zen 3) (2020−2022) architecture (7 nm), while the Xeon Platinum 8362 uses Ice Lake-SP (2021) (10 nm). In PassMark, the Ryzen 7 5700X scores 26,609 against the Xeon Platinum 8362's 56,787 — a 72.4% lead for the Xeon Platinum 8362. L3 cache: 32 MB (total) on the Ryzen 7 5700X vs 48 MB (total) on the Xeon Platinum 8362.
